Itinerary Highlights

Madrid: Royal Palace, Old Town and Poets District Tour - Itinerary Highlights

The tour begins at Calle de Cervantes, 11 (Casa de Quevedo) and takes visitors on a journey through 17 significant sites across Madrid’s historic landmarks.

Key stops include the Teatro Español, Plaza de Santa Ana, Plaza de Jacinto Benavente, Puerta del Sol, Plaza Mayor, Almudena Cathedral, and the Royal Palace of Madrid.

The tour culminates at the stunning Plaza de Oriente.

Along the way, the knowledgeable guide will bring the city’s history and culture to life through engaging storytelling, providing ample opportunities for questions and a deeper understanding of Madrid’s rich heritage.

Taking in the Poets District

Madrid: Royal Palace, Old Town and Poets District Tour - Taking in the Poets District

Madrid’s Poets District beckons visitors to enjoy the city’s rich literary heritage.

Strolling through the narrow alleyways, you’ll discover the former residences of renowned Spanish poets like Cervantes, Quevedo, and Lope de Vega. The tour guide shares captivating stories about these literary giants, bringing their legacies to life.

Along the way, you’ll visit the iconic Teatro Español, a theater that has hosted generations of Spanish playwrights and actors.

The lively Plaza de Santa Ana, a hub for writers and artists, offers a chance to soak up the district’s vibrant atmosphere.

Enjoy Madrid’s poetic soul and uncover the city’s enduring literary traditions.
